Nassau Savings and Loan Association was a federally chartered savings and loan (S&L) institution, also known as a "thrift," that primarily served communities in Nassau County, New York. Like other S&Ls of its era, its core business was accepting savings deposits from the public and providing mortgage loans for residential properties. The institution failed during the widespread U.S. Savings and Loan crisis and was placed into receivership with the Resolution Trust Corporation. On February 21, 1992, its assets were acquired by The Dime Savings Bank of New York, FSB.
